However, this pursuit of convenience carries significant risks. Microsoft officially ended support for FrontPage in 2006 and ended extended support for the entire Office 2003 suite in 2014. This means the software receives no security updates or patches. Furthermore, modern web standards (HTML5, CSS3, responsive design) have rendered the code output of FrontPage 2003 largely incompatible with today's internet. A website built in FrontPage would rely on proprietary extensions and outdated tags that modern browsers may struggle to render correctly. In a professional context, using FrontPage today is essentially building a digital relic rather than a modern application. download microsoft office frontpage 2003 portable hot
